Description

Our Kitchen Assistants/Team Members are responsible for preparing our food offering to the highest quality and standards.
Their role is crucial in maintaining a smooth and efficient operation in the kitchen.
Opening hours: from 10.00am to 2.00am from Monday to Sunday

What you\’ll do at Pasta Evangelists:

  • Ensuring that the kitchen is set up and ready for each service with the right amount of prepared Pasta Sauces and other ingredients that ensure the right amount for quick service but does not negatively impact food costs i.e. wastage. Including preparing par levels in the pre-prepared cold delivery fridge
  • Wear a full smart clean uniform to the brand standard at all times whilst on shift and protective clothing as required.
  • Ensure the full Pasta Evangelists Standard is adhered to, thereby ensuring our Pasta and other Products are kept to the highest possible standard for Best product quality to our customer.
  • To ensure that the kitchen is exceptionally clean and complies with all Health and Safety / Quality and Safety regulations.
  • To keep an eye on the Availability and Inform the Team leaders and wider team in advance.
  • Document and keep a record of information on food as appropriate to the company policy and effective date labelling and make sure stock rotation principles (FIFO) are fully adhered to.
  • Ensure that all par levels are maintained.
  • Ensure any food wastage is recorded accurately.
  • Utilise the SOP to maximise the quality and speed of food readiness.
  • For all equipment i.e. Fridges, Pasta Boiler, Ovens, Microwaves etc ensure that the right temperature records are kept and the correct procedures are followed for safe food handling.
  • Ensure all equipment is maintained to the SOP standard. E.g. Kitchen management system, oven, fridges, freezers etc.
  • Preparing and cooking food to the highest of standards and complying with the preparation of all food that meets Pasta Evangelist’s requirements as laid out within “How to Cards”
  • Ensure all food is prepared quickly, in the correct order, to the How to Card standard and in line with all SOP’s.
  • Full Checking deliveries into the Store and reporting any issues to the Team Leader/ Manager. To Ensure that all deliveries are Received & stored appropriately and storage requirements are adhered to.
  • Full Operating the wash-up area effectively and ensuring any equipment used is thoroughly cleaned.
  • Full Use correct signage whilst cleaning is taking place.
  • Full Ensure that all rubbish is disposed of correctly at all times, following the company waste management processes in relation to recycling and adhering to Local Authority requirements.
  • Reporting of any equipment defects quickly to Team leader or Area Manager.
  • Full Ensure that all close down kitchen procedures are followed and that the kitchen is always clean and prepared as possible for the next shift.
  • Full Regularly organise pest checks and report any concerns to the Team leader and higher management.

Pasta Evangelists was born nine years ago out of a desire to become the authority in fresh pasta. We’re on a mission to reimagine and elevate pasta as a category, which is worth a staggering £3.8bn yet has seen little innovation for decades.
Since launching our original fresh pasta recipe kit service in 2016, we have built a cult following of British pasta lovers – our Evangelists – who are passionate about discovering the breadth and variety of pasta, as well as the irresistible stories behind it.
Today, Pasta Evangelists is backed by Barilla (the world’s biggest pasta company) and is proud to be the UK’s biggest pasta brand by revenues, as well as one of the UK’s fastest-growing startups . In addition to our website, our recipe kits are also available for customers to purchase through major online retailers like Ocado.
Building on this success, we are now disrupting Britain’s pizza-centric Italian dining scene with the launch of our very own Pasta Evangelists restaurants along with our high-end Harrods Pasta Bar . These are not just Italian eateries — they are vibrant destinations where guests can experience the extraordinary diversity of pasta, alongside exceptional service, bold creativity, and a true passion for great food. You can visit us at our first locations in Chiswick, Richmond, Greenwich and Farringdon, where guests can enjoy a delicious meal and also take part in our much loved pasta-making classes.
At the same time, we continue to expand our fresh pasta takeaway concept, available on pastaevangelists.com and through major delivery platforms like Deliveroo, UberEats and JustEat. With more than 40 kitchens now operating across the UK — including in Scotland and Wales — we are growing our footprint rapidly and bringing fresh pasta to more customers every day.
Our state-of-the-art Pastificio in Acton, West London — the largest in the UK — enables us to produce a wide range of artisanal pasta and sauces, pushing the boundaries of what’s possible in this beloved category.
Looking ahead, our key focus is on opening more restaurants and creating unique spaces that celebrate pasta in all its shapes, offering something far beyond the traditional Italian experience.
